Great pic! I have not seen that one prior, but do have pictures of that Cherokee at the Chicago auto show, Circa January of 1967. The Cherokee in the Brother's Collection is a later built car and the only known Cherokee to exist. Their car had an L78 engine and was used to Pace the CanAM race at Road America in 1967.
